Chiropractic Care and Studies on Stroke by Health Professional Radio published on 2019-06-18T05:50:11Z Dr. Gerard Clum, D.C., Board Member of the Foundation for Chiropractic Progress, addresses the issues surrounding neck manipulation and strokes. There have been numerous medical studies showing there is no causal link between strokes and chiropractic care. The latest study, published in the Annals of Medicine on April 6, 2019, concludes that "manual therapy does not result in an increased risk of cervical artery dissection or CAD.” Visit www.hpr.fm to listen to more interviews about healthcare and research findings.
